Harley-Davidson Touring description

This is a 2005 Harley Davidson Electra Glide Ultra Classic, Peace Officer Special Edition, with a Screamin' Eagle package.  It is painted in Harley Davidson Peace Officer Blue with custom artwork on the fairing.  The bike has been upgraded to the Screamin' Eagle package to include the Screamin' Eagle 95" Big Bore kit, Screamin' Eagle Exhaust, and a Screamin Eagle racing tuner.  All upgrades were installed by Grand Teton Harley Davidson in Idaho Falls, Idaho.  This bike has an AM/FM/WX/CD/CB/Int with 4 speakers.  It includes volume control for both rider and passenger, as well as push to talk for rider and passenger, and has electronic cruise control.  For a touch of customization it also has blue LED cent lighting on the engine and under the tour pack.

The tires are only a year old and I have not had time to ride much this year, so tire tread is nearly new.  The bike is due for a new front break rotor, but I have not had the time to get it done yet.  There are no other defects and the bike is in fantastic condition.

Vespa goes back to the future

Thu, 22 Nov 2012

IT'S been a while coming, but the gorgeous Vespa 946 - EICMA 2012's Best of Show - has finally introduced something to the two-wheeled world that our four-wheeled counterparts have had for a while.  I call this 'reverse retro-futurism' - the art of borrowing lines from models past and imbuing them with a sleek sense of future direction (as opposed to retro-futurism, the pre-1960s design trend of depicting the technology of the future. The term 'decopunk' may come close, but feel free to tell me if there's a more exact term.) It's what the New Mini and the New Beetle (both 1997 and 2012 versions) have done so well, and so successfully: building an all-new model as a tribute to a classic, something that's modern yet already timeless, with a widely-appreciated, inclusive aesthetic (and here we eliminate the Plymouth PT Cruiser from the conversation). The biking world is great at retro, indeed thrives on it, but not so good at adding in a taste of the 21st century.

2011 Indy Mile Cancelled

Fri, 19 Aug 2011

Indy Mile officials have decided to cancel this year’s AMA Flat Track round due to the continuing investigation into the fatal stage rigging accident at the Indiana State Fair. The Aug. 13 tragedy killed five people and injured dozens after winds reaching as high as 70 mph caused the stage to collapse.

Dashboard Camera Footage Shows State Trooper Rear-Ending Motorcycle

Fri, 13 Sep 2013

Newly-released footage from a police cruiser’s dashboard camera shows the car rear-ending a couple on a motorcycle. Ohio State Police are investigating the Aug. 17 crash which resulted in serious but non-life-threatening injuries to Beavercreek, Ohio, residents Corey Waldman and his wife Amy Waldman.
